What makes Laravel the Best Framework for your project? - PowerPoint PPT Presentation

About This Presentation
Title:

What makes Laravel the Best Framework for your project?

Description:

Laravel is a highly favored framework among developers and is commonly chosen as the go-to option for web development. But with the variety of other frameworks available, selecting the best technology can be a daunting task. Many developers find it tiresome to determine the right match for their project. By opting for Laravel, developers can reduce the burden of code maintenance and focus on other important aspects. This can save time and ensure that all necessary details are taken care of. There are several compelling reasons why choosing Laravel for your project is a wise decision. – PowerPoint PPT presentation

Number of Views:3
Slides: 10
Provided by: Cubettech
Tags:

less

Transcript and Presenter's Notes

Title: What makes Laravel the Best Framework for your project?


1
What Makes LARAVEL
The Best Framework For Your Project?
2
Model View Controller
  • Ensures clarity between presentation and logic,
    leading to better performance, reliability, and
    documentation.
  • Convenient for building small and large-scale
    business applications.
  • Comes with in-built features like ORM, data
    migration, auVitehwentication system, and
    pagination.
  • Simplifies file organization for large software
    projects. Effective for complex projects.

3
Object-oriented Libraries
Laravel uses MVC and has an expressive,
object-oriented syntax. Comes with pre-installed
libraries and modules for developers. Adopts PHP
principles for responsive web app
development. MVC design pattern allows for code
compatibility with the framework. Follows best
development practices for creating
code. Object-oriented libraries make project
modification and maintenance easier.
4
Templating Engine
Blade feature allows for lightweight templates to
create class-based components. Can be used
anywhere in a PHP application. Aims to create
layouts with content seeding options. Useful tool
for processing codes in source templates and
directing output to a file or stream. Blade
combines with the data model without adding
overhead to the app. Provides controlled
structures like loops, comments, and if
statements for developers.
5
Command-line Interface
Provides access for programming and maintenance
tasks. Handles commands in plain text and
simplifies development. Artisan is a popular
global tool driven by Symfony console. Manages
database, authentication, migration, assets
publishing, and authorization. Adds records to
the database through seeding, models, migrations,
and controls.
6
ORM and Database Management
Laravel uses object-relational mapping ORM, also
called Eloquent. The ORM features an abstract
base interface and allows interaction with
database objects using expressive syntax. Takes
advantage of active record implementation for
customizing and building models. Aimed at simple
relational mapping between complex tables.
Developers can modify the database schema and
share it with different developers.
7
Support and Security
Laravel has strong testing features that prevent
regressions Unit testing can be easily executed
with the artisan command line utility Security
measures in Laravel include user login, data
encryption, password management, route
protection, and user authentication Code
integrity and application security are also
prioritized Laravel's built-in encryption
mechanism enhances security and prevents
unauthorized access Laravel focuses on security
measures such as user authentication, login, data
encryption, password management, and route
protection.
8
Open Source Enterprise Solution
Laravel is open source with a dedicated community
support Offers transparency and easy
collaboration Provides access to tutorials and
solutions from the Laravel community Ideal for
enterprise solutions with a vibrant
ecosystem Empowers businesses to develop dynamic
projects faster with elegant syntax.
9
Say goodbye to complex coding

Hello to streamlined web development. Choose
Laravel and start building your dream project
today.
Get Started!
Write a Comment
User Comments (0)
About PowerShow.com